ganglia puppet module Author: Daniel Leyden Contributor: Jean-Daniel BUSSY Contributor: K Jonathan "Jesusaurus" Harker Contributor: Andy Shinn Contributor: Alex Kitching Supports the installation of ganglia using puppet with multiclusters like described here: http://sourceforge.net/apps/trac/ganglia/wiki/ganglia_quick_start This module is published under the Apache 2.0 license - http://www.apache.org/licenses/LICENSE-2.0 Requires puppet-concat module: https://github.com/puppet-modules/puppet-concat.git ===== Sample Usage: node 'hostname' { class { 'ganglia::client': cluster => 'mycluster', } # Begin - Default Ganglia Module and Metric Config ganglia::module { 'core_metrics': path => false, deploy => false; 'cpu_module': path => '/usr/lib/ganglia/modcpu.so', deploy => false; 'disk_module': path => '/usr/lib/ganglia/moddisk.so', deploy => false; 'load_module': path => '/usr/lib/ganglia/modload.so', deploy => false; 'mem_module': path => '/usr/lib/ganglia/modmem.so', deploy => false; 'net_module': path => '/usr/lib/ganglia/modnet.so', deploy => false; 'proc_module': path => '/usr/lib/ganglia/modproc.so', deploy => false; 'sys_module': path => '/usr/lib/ganglia/modsys.so', deploy => false; } ganglia::collection_group { 'Heartbeat': collect_once => true, time_threshold => 20, collect_every => false; } ganglia::collection_group { 'General_Info': collect_once => true, time_threshold => 1200, collect_every => false; } ganglia::metric { 'cpu_num': collection_group => 'General_Info', title => 'CPU Count'; 'cpu_speed': collection_group => 'General_Info', title => 'CPU Speed'; 'mem_total': collection_group => 'General_Info', title => 'Memory Total'; 'swap_total': collection_group => 'General_Info', title => 'Swap Space Total'; 'boottime': collection_group => 'General_Info', title => 'Last Boot Time'; 'machine_type': collection_group => 'General_Info', title => 'Machine Type'; 'os_name': collection_group => 'General_Info', title => 'Operating System'; 'os_release': collection_group => 'General_Info', title => 'Operating System Release'; 'location': collection_group => 'General_Info', title => 'Location'; } ganglia::collection_group { 'Gexec': collect_once => true, time_threshold => 300, collect_every => false; } ganglia::metric { 'gexec': collection_group => 'Gexec', title => 'Gexec Status'; } ganglia::collection_group { 'CPU_Stats': collect_every => 20, time_threshold => 90; } ganglia::metric { 'cpu_user':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U User'; 'cpu_system':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U System'; 'cpu_idle': collection_group => 'CPU_Stats', value_threshold => '5.0', title => 'CPU Idle'; 'cpu_nice':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U Nice'; 'cpu_aidle': collection_group => 'CPU_Stats', value_threshold => '5.0', title => 'CPU aidle'; 'cpu_wio':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U wio'; 'cpu_intr':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U intr'; 'cpu_sintr': collection_group => 'CPU_Stats', value_threshold => '1.0', title => 'CPU sintr'; } ganglia::collection_group { 'Load_Averages': collect_every => 20, time_threshold => 90; } ganglia::metric { 'load_one': title => 'One Minute Load Average', value_threshold => '1.0', collection_group => 'Load_Averages'; 'load_five': title => 'Five Minute Load Average', value_threshold => '1.0', collection_group => 'Load_Averages'; 'load_fifteen': title => 'Fifteen Minute Load Average', value_threshold => '1.0', collection_group => 'Load_Averages'; } ganglia::collection_group { 'Processes': collect_every => 80, time_threshold => 950; } ganglia::metric { 'proc_run': title => 'Total Running Processes', value_threshold => '1.0', collection_group => 'Processes'; 'proc_total': title => 'Total Processes', value_threshold => '1.0', collection_group => 'Processes'; } ganglia::collection_group { 'Memory_Stats': collect_every => 40, time_threshold => 180; } ganglia::metric { 'mem_free': title => 'Free Memory', value_threshold => '1024.0', collection_group => 'Memory_Stats'; 'mem_shared': title => 'Shared Memory', value_threshold => '1024.0', collection_group => 'Memory_Stats'; 'mem_buffers': title => 'Memory Buffers', value_threshold => '1024.0', collection_group => 'Memory_Stats'; 'mem_cached': title => 'Cached Memory', value_threshold => '1024.0', collection_group => 'Memory_Stats'; 'swap_free': title => 'Free Swap Space', value_threshold => '1024.0', collection_group => 'Memory_Stats'; } ganglia::collection_group { 'Network': collect_every => 40, time_threshold => 300; } ganglia::metric { 'bytes_out': title => 'Bytes Sent', value_threshold => '4096', collection_group => 'Network'; 'bytes_in': title => 'Bytes Received', value_threshold => '4096', collection_group => 'Network'; 'pkts_out': title => 'Packets Sent', value_threshold => '256', collection_group => 'Network'; 'pkts_in': title => 'Packets Received', value_threshold => '256', collection_group => 'Network'; } ganglia::collection_group { 'Disk_-_Static': collect_every => 1800, time_threshold => 3600; } ganglia::metric { 'disk_total': title => 'Total Disk Space', value_threshold => '1.0', collection_group => 'Disk_-_Static'; } ganglia::collection_group { 'Disk': collect_every => 40, time_threshold => 180; } ganglia::metric { 'disk_free': title => 'Disk Space Available', value_threshold => '1.0', collection_group => 'Disk'; 'part_max_used': title => 'Maximum Disk Space Used', value_threshold => '1.0', collection_group => 'Disk'; } # End - Default Ganglia Module and Metric Config ganglia::module { 'cputemp_module': language => 'bash'; } ganglia::collection_group { 'CPU_Temperature': collect_every => 600, time_threshold => 20; } ganglia::metric { 'cputemp': title => 'CPU Temperatures', value_threshold => '70', collection_group => 'CPU_Temperature'; } }
